Friends of the Orange County Public Library Executive Board Meeting - March 8, 2010

DRAFT

Present: Janet Flowers, Ann Burton, Linda Schmitt, Susanne Vergara, Sandy Gerstner and Bill Barrows

Co-Chair, Janet Flowers, called the meeting to order at 4:00PM.

Minutes from the February board meeting were approved. Treasurer, Sandy Gerstner, gave the monthly financial report ( original attached to minutes). Checking balance = $ I 4.076.31. Friends will have to file an IRS Form #990 this year due to amount earned in paver sales. Amount given to library director at time of opening ($20,000) has been used to purchase security system, teen center furnishings and photo exhibit.

Ann presented the following guidelines for Friends funding requests:

I. With a written request and the approval of the Board, the FOCPL Funds can provide for the following:

Collection development Library equip1nent and furniture Library technology Library services Special library programs Staff development 2. Funds raised by the FOCPL cannot be designated for any use that does not benefit the OCPL and its patrons. 3. The Board of the Friends reserves the right to refuse gifts.

Board agreed to accept this policy. Janet gave an update on paver program. Brochures and business cards have been printed for program. Deadline for sales is July 1, 2010. Members of paver committee are Janet Flowers, Ann Burton, Annie O'Leary, Lisa Wolfe, Ed Flowers, Sandy Gerstner, and Barbara Null. Bartow Culp has volunteered to visit the businesses in downtown Hillsborough.

Susanne reported that plans are continuing for April 24, 3 :00PM literary event co-sponsored by the Friends, Eno River Publishing and Purple Crow books. Janet and Susanne will design a poster for the event. and will distribute copies around the area. Sound system will be borrowed from Arts Council.

Ann announced that on-going book sale is very successful! Books donated must be clean. Prices are:

Copyrights from 2000 on ..... Hardbacks $2.00 Paperbacks $ 1.00

 

Copyrights fron1 1990 - 1999 ...... 1-Iardbacks $1.00 Paperbacks . 5 0

DVDs, audio books $ I - $2 ***Exceptions 1nay be very expensive books (over $30.00) Ann also announced that endowment committee now consists of John Idol, Jim Burton and Bartow Culp. Janet sent membership renewal letters to 144 people. New memberships/renewals continue to be received. Janet also put forth a tentative calendar for the remainder of the year: April 11-17 National Library Week 24 Friends Literary Event July - Friends event (TBD) Sept. - Book sale with preview night for members only Oct. 12-23 National Friends Week Friends Event (TBD) Dec. - Annual Meeting Janet is in the process of organizing past Friends files since organization was formed in 1981. Meeting was adjoined at 5: 15. Submitted by Linda Schmitt, Secretary
